80/**
81 * struct switchdev_ops - switchdev operations
82 *
83 * @switchdev_port_attr_get: Get a port attribute (see switchdev_attr).
84 *
85 * @switchdev_port_attr_set: Set a port attribute (see switchdev_attr).
86 *
87 * @switchdev_port_obj_add: Add an object to port (see switchdev_obj).
88 *
89 * @switchdev_port_obj_del: Delete an object from port (see switchdev_obj).
90 *
91 * @switchdev_port_obj_dump: Dump port objects (see switchdev_obj).
92 */
93struct switchdev_ops {
94 int (*switchdev_port_attr_get)(struct net_device *dev,
95 struct switchdev_attr *attr);
96 int (*switchdev_port_attr_set)(struct net_device *dev,
97 struct switchdev_attr *attr);
98 int (*switchdev_port_obj_add)(struct net_device *dev,
99 struct switchdev_obj *obj);
100 int (*switchdev_port_obj_del)(struct net_device *dev,
101 struct switchdev_obj *obj);
102 int (*switchdev_port_obj_dump)(struct net_device *dev,
103 struct switchdev_obj *obj);
104};
